online auctions: Consider online auctions to sell your property in less than 30 days - 11/07/07 04:44 PM
Some folks who want to sell their property don't want to pay commissions and want to move the property fast at market rate.  With the auction method one can list and sell a property in this time frame at market and have the buyer pick up the commission.  There are a few caveats, which include providing clear title, required inspections and an initial marketing fee to properly advertise the property.

online auctions: Auction method providing alternative in troubled real estate market - 10/15/07 05:31 PM
Live and online auctions have been around for a while for both personal property and real estate.  It has always been seen as an alternative that, until now, has not really been a primary consideration.  With property sitting on the market the way it has been as of late one with a significant amount of equity can move all types of real estate through a live auction and have a 30 day close.  With proper marketing, which should be your auctioneer's specialty, having a lively and competitive bidding process has proven to be the norm.
